Let's Play Final Gears of Fantasy War aka Japanese Fantasy Mass Effect aka...![]() The Last Story is an RPG directed by the man who created the Final Fantasy series, with music by the man who made the music for most of the Final Fantasy series that neither plays nor sounds anything like a Final Fantasy game. What we have here is a japanese game about swords and magic that takes its primary mechanical inspiration from modern western cover based shooters, plays mostly in real time and has a dodge roll yet seems to be actively trying not to be too much of an action game. The game puts a lot of emphasis on level design and on making the presence of a party tactically important without giving the player full micro-managey control over them. It's a unique and interesting game that's kind of hard to describe in text (that's what the videos are for). Story Stuff The world is dying and no one really seems to know why. Wherever you go, the wind carries snow-like flakes of dead geography. ![]() This is Zael, we'll be spending the vast majority of the game controling him. He's a member of a mercenary band along with these people: ![]() They've all come to Lazulis island, a place where nature mysteriously still flourishes, with a reputation for being one of the safest and most peaceful places in the empire. This might seem like a weird place for mercenaries to go but they've been hired by the local count to clear out a cave of monsters (where we join them in media res) and Dagran, their leader, thinks there's more work where that came from and if they keep at it maybe even a way out of the mercenary lifestyle.
